What is the function of Low-density lipoprotein?

The function of low density lipoproteins are to carry cholesterol molecules through the body. The cholesterol can be used in membranes for transport or to make hormones.

Is sodium a high density or low density element?

Quite low density: 0.968 g·cm−3
